Under a Canopy of Colour: Discover Ballarat’s Umbrella Laneway

Ballarat Umbrella Laneway
Tucked into the heart of regional Victoria, Ballarat Umbrella Laneway, also known as Hop Lane, has become one of the city’s most photographed and talked-about urban surprises. Floating high above the bluestone path, a canopy of vibrant umbrellas transforms this once-quiet laneway into a joyful, ever-changing outdoor art installation that delights visitors year-round.

A Hidden Gem in Ballarat Central

Located along Armstrong Street North in Ballarat Central, Hop Lane sits perfectly between popular local venues Roy Hammond and Hop Temple. Its central position makes it an easy stop while exploring the city’s historic streets, cafés and boutiques, yet it still feels like a delightful discovery for those encountering it for the first time.

The laneway’s transformation has turned a simple pedestrian thoroughfare into a visual landmark, drawing photographers, families and travellers eager to experience Ballarat beyond its famous gold rush history.

A Living Installation That Changes with the Seasons

One of the most captivating features of Ballarat Umbrella Laneway is its seasonal reinvention. The colourful umbrellas remain on display all year round, but their colours are regularly refreshed to reflect changing seasons, events and creative themes. This ensures that no two visits are ever quite the same, encouraging repeat visits and fresh photographs every time.

Sunlight filters through the umbrellas during the day, casting playful shadows on the laneway below, while evenings bring a softer, atmospheric glow that enhances its charm.
